Formation Fluid Management Inc.: Mr. Al Radford, CEO Resigns Due to Health Reasons

20/09/2011 3:17am

Marketwired Canada


Formation Fluid Management Inc. (TSX VENTURE:FFM) ("The Company") announces with
regret the resignation for personal health reasons of Mr. Al Radford. Mr.
Radford's resignation from his positions of President, Chief Executive Officer
and Director is effective immediately and the full Board of Directors will act
in the role of interim President and Chief Executive Officer while a search for
a suitable replacement for Mr. Radford is conducted.


Mr. Radford will continue to be available as a consultant to assist the Company
as required. The entire Board and all the staff of FFM thank Mr. Radford for his
service and valuable contributions to the growth of the Company and wish him a
speedy and successful recovery and all the best in his future endeavors.


About Formation Fluid Corp.

Formation Fluid Technology (Formation Fluids) has developed a waste water
treatment plant that uses a proprietary process to clean waste water. The system
is mobile and can be scaled to process required volumes. This system treats
water to meet or exceed CCME Guidelines (Canadian Environmental Quality
Guidelines), resulting in reusable water that can be used for: Boilers, Frac
Water, Water Floods, and Drilling Operations. Formation Fluids is seeking to
service a significantly underdeveloped segment within the oil and gas industry;
its waste water treatment system is intended to cost effectively deal with
produced water while satisfying the need to reuse and recycle an increasing
